Exploring the Top Android App Development Companies on the Market

Advertising Disclosure

Advertising disclosure:

Our partners compensate us. This may influence which products or services we review (also where and how those products appear on the site), this in no way affects our recommendations or the advice we offer. Our reviews are based on years of experience and countless hours of research. Our partners cannot pay us to guarantee favorable reviews of their products or services.

Android technology is quickly becoming a favored mobile platform for both consumers and businesses. Therefore, there's a growing demand for skilled app development firms that specialize and follow trends in Android applications.

We have curated a definitive list of the top eleven companies for Android app development, designed to help you select a top-tier firm with confidence and ease. Our list features highly esteemed trailblazers committed to developing high-quality applications that can transform your innovative Android app vision into a reality.

Android App Development Companies: The 11 You Need to Know:

android app development companies

1. ScienceSoft


One of the top mobile app development companies is ScienceSoft, which was established in 1989 in Texas, USA. The company provides IT consulting, web design, and software development services, with over 14 years of experience in Android application development and over 350 completed projects.

ScienceSoft has a team of 30+ expert Android app developers with extensive knowledge in Java, Kotlin, JavaScript, and C#. It can deliver seamless native or cross-platform apps with remarkable functionality, agility, and scalability. Be it custom mobile apps, SDKs, or back-end integration, its service suite extends beyond technical capabilities to include front-end design, web development, API, and back-end configuration.

ScienceSoft offers industry-specific solutions that cater to diverse sectors, ranging from healthcare, retail, and finance to media and entertainment. Its bespoke solutions are customized to meet each industry’s unique needs, resulting in exceptional outcomes and unparalleled support. One such project it’s proud of is Viber, a messaging app that has now surpassed 1 billion users and has revolutionized communication for its global audience.

ScienceSoft delivers bespoke software development services, leveraging the expertise of experienced professionals to tailor solutions that meet clients’ unique needs. With secure and scalable software products and ongoing maintenance, it keeps clients’ solutions up-to-date and optimized.

2. OpenXcell


OpenXcell is a top Android app development company founded in India and is now based in the USA. They lead the industry with innovative mobile solutions through an experienced team. By quickly building offshore teams using available profiles, costs and recruitment hassles are reduced.

The company offers end-to-end Android app development, UI/UX design, web app development, and enterprise software development. By integrating Artificial Intelligence (AI) and Machine Learning expertise, it provides tailored digital transformation solutions that analyze user information and behavior. OpenXcell serves multiple industries, focusing on addressing specific business challenges and delivering long-term success through secure, robust, and feature-rich Android app development services for various devices.

What sets OpenXCell apart from other app development companies is its passion for quality solutions that exceed clients’ expectations by continually updating the product and running multiple quality checks, thereby guaranteeing maximum satisfaction. It leverages the top 1% of talent in the Indian IT industry to help clients reduce operational costs while providing high-end mobile app solutions. Moreover, as it’s committed to giving clients full ownership and control over their source code and intellectual property, OpenXcell is a safe and reliable partner for all mobile app development needs.

3. Cubix


Since 2008, Cubix has built its portfolio in delivering successful custom software architecture and development for startups, enterprises, and Fortune 500 companies like PayPal, Tissot, Estée Lauder, Politico, Walmart, Sapient, and Canon.

Located in Florida, this company excels at developing mobile games, websites, apps, and enterprise-wide software solutions. With advanced offerings in IoT, Blockchain, and machine learning industries, its digital solutions are top-notch.

Cubix is a leading full-stack app dev company, handling the entire app development process, from concept to deployment. With the best Android app developers, it excels in complex app design, quality assurance, strength testing, and user experience optimization. It offers full-time support for Android devices and continuously updates its apps to ensure maximum functionality and user satisfaction.

From small businesses to large enterprises, its app development process stays the same. The team at Cubix of mobile app developers can turn your ideas into engaging, robust, and user-friendly mobile apps that can become an integral part of people’s lives.

4. Surf


Surf has been providing mobile development for 12 years and has a global presence. It has developed applications for leading brands in banking, food tech, human resources, fintech, and more. With its open-source toolkit SurfGear, it has a reliable, time-saving framework for designing and developing apps.

Surf has expertise in cross-platform development, having developed multiple mobile applications with the top tech stack around. It is proficient in design and cloud infrastructure and can create powerful web services to ensure the smooth scaling of projects. Surf’s team of developers is experienced in crafting solutions tailored to the needs of various industries and can help create the best user experience for mobile apps.

The company’s Android app development services include UI/UX design, code optimization, testing, API integration, and support services. It also provides technical consulting to ensure that everyone understands the project thoroughly before moving forward with development. With a focus on timeliness and innovation in all projects, Surf is one of the top Android app development companies.

5. Codal


Established in 2009 in Chicago, Codal delivers full-cycle app development from UX design to creation and post-launch maintenance. It also offers technical consulting on cloud deployment, big data analytics, and technical architecture. Its team collaborates with clients to produce digital solutions that solve real challenges. Having successfully completed 200+ projects with more to come, it is committed to empowering brand visibility and creating elegant web and mobile solutions.

When it comes to Android development, Codal does it all. Its developers are competent in Java, Kotlin, and other programming languages, delivering top-notch native Android apps for various industries. Moreover, its team of UX designers can create beautiful visuals to match the quality of code that goes into the app, making it one of the top Android app development companies.

Codal has partnered with BigCommerce and Shopify, industry leaders who share its zeal for empowering organizations in the digital age. Its strategic planning revolves around cutting-edge tools and services. These valued partnerships ensure clients get the worth of these products.


Codal is a full-stack mobile app development and UX design agency with offices in Chicago, India, and England.

Industry Focus

1 - 10

Chicago, IL

Best for:

Enterprise, Midmarket and Small Business

Minimum Campaign Size: $50.000+
Industry Focus
Business services
Consumer products & services
Financials services
Web development
UX/UI Design
Mobile App Development
Minimum Campaign Size: $50.000+


Codal is a full-stack mobile app development and UX design agency with offices in Chicago, India, and England.

6. ArcTouch


Based in San Francisco, California, ArcTouch has 350+ experts in product strategy, UX/UI design, and software development. It creates apps, websites, and connected experiences that foster meaningful customer connections, serving Fortune 500 companies, leading brands, and startups since 2009.

In 2016, WPP acquired ArcTouch. Today, now a part of AKQA, it’s recognized as a top mobile app developer with over 250 team members. Its clients benefit from the care of a boutique specialist with the scale of a billion-dollar company. Its leadership team consists of experienced Silicon Valley entrepreneurs and creative technologists.

The Android development expertise of ArcTouch includes BLE and NFC connectivity, rapid prototyping, and staff augmentation. With a variety of tailored services, it can assist your existing team or manage your entire Android app project from start to launch. Moreover, its multi-day discovery workshop helps transform your app idea into actionable, first-generation features by identifying the intersection of business opportunity and user needs. This is what ArcTouch is all about—creating powerful apps with an innovative approach that will only lead to success.

7. Vention


At Vention (formerly known as iTechArt), top developers are sourced from tech destinations worldwide, leveraging its expansive footprint. Based in New York and with key locations across the US and Europe, its team of 3,000 experts specializes in customizable, durable, and scalable Android solutions for businesses of all sizes, from early-stage start-ups to enterprise clients. It offers two models of Android app development—project-based and augmenting your existing app on an ongoing basis, always working alongside your in-house team and adapting to your routines.

Vention’s technology team constantly learns via its Student Lab internship program, local meetups, and talks with senior engineers. If you are searching for an Android development team that boasts both technical proficiency and process maturity, Vention is the clear winner. Drawing upon over two decades of invaluable expertise and fueled by an unbridled passion for the Android platform, this team has indisputably outpaced the competition. They have established themselves as the premier developers for all your Android development needs. This team of experts blends technical mastery with a true passion for their craft, making them the ultimate choice.

8. RipenApps


RipenApps is an industry-leading Android app development company with a successful record of creating top-grossing Android apps for various verticals that you can find on the app store. With offices in the USA, India, Australia, the UK, and UAE, it has been developing quality applications for over 800 entrepreneurs, start-ups, SMBs, and enterprises. With a user-centric design model, RipenApps offers high-performance apps that cater to the distinct needs of businesses.

Backed by the latest tech, the Android app development services of RipenApps can help you tap into Android’s market share effectively and affordably. Its 6-year industry experience and its team of expert Android developers in both hybrid and native app development have earned it global recognition.

RipenApps offers the Extended Team Model, enabling clients to control development teams remotely and paying only for the team, not infrastructure—a cost-effective solution. Its Time and Material Model fits agile projects that use hourly, weekly, or monthly rates for resources, materials, or expenses applied in the development process. It is ideal for small-scale projects with milestone-based roadmaps under a fixed budget, expediting operations and optimizing deliverables. With that said, choosing RipenApps will get you exceptional Android app solutions with international standards, talented and experienced developers, transparency and communication, on-time delivery, and round-the-clock customer support.

9. Emerline


Emerline specializes in full-cycle software engineering. With 12+ years of experience, the company has delivered over 250 successful projects across various sectors. As part of LeverX Group, it prides itself on customer service and creating quality products that make businesses stand out on Google Play Store.

The team at Emerline has developed various apps for retail, manufacturing, healthcare, and education. Their services range from design and development to third-party integrations.

The company also offers additional support services such as cloud hosting, DevOps, and maintenance. Emerline’s primary goal is to help businesses succeed with Android app projects by creating best-in-class solutions tailored to the customer’s specific needs. Its services extend beyond design, with experts in machine learning models and quality assurance testing. It also offers long-term support and maintenance, ensuring apps remain competitive.

Emerline is renowned for its professionalism, responsiveness, and diligence in delivering full-cycle software engineering services for Android app development. Unsurprisingly, its clients confidently recommend it as a reliable technology partner for large and complex development projects.

10. Mobulous


Mobulous is a modern mobile app firm that creates intuitive Android and iOS apps for businesses with state-of-the-art technologies. With over 8 years of experience and presence in India and the US, its team of expert developers and tech professionals provides tailored solutions to fulfill business objectives.

As a prominent software development company, Mobulous is renowned for its transparent communication, punctual delivery, and uninterrupted customer support. Its extensive service suite encompasses native and hybrid app development, UI/UX design, backend development, third-party integrations, and quality assurance testing.

With a diverse clientele from eCommerce, healthcare, fintech, real estate, and education sectors, Mobulous boasts a rich work portfolio. Its skilled team of top Android app developers adheres to the highest standards of quality and meticulousness, rendering it one of the industry’s premier Android app development companies.

11. Geniusee


Geniusee is an AWS-certified software development company that delivers cutting-edge technology solutions to global enterprises. Aside from iOS development, its mastery of Java, C++, C#, and Android SDK translates into creating peerless mobile and web applications that boast high functionality and security.

Geniusee is a top contender in custom software development, providing comprehensive maintenance and support services. It guides clients to design cost-effective, innovative products, building loyal relationships with business giants and startups alike.

Moreover, the company values the function and appearance of a mobile app. But to achieve perfection in these areas, it ensures a team with expert knowledge in business, technology, and user experience. Its bespoke services cater exclusively to your vision. Experts in the team will listen intently to your unique needs and preferences, ensuring your vision comes to life. Count on them for unwavering commitment to exceptional quality and cutting-edge innovation. They can be your ultimate partner in blazing a trail to digital success.

Final Thoughts

The companies listed here are all well-known for providing quality Android app development services. As the best Android app development companies, their experienced teams can help you develop an app that meets your business needs and stands out on Google Play Store. When choosing a company, it is essential to consider the type of service, budget, time frame, and experience level.

Conducting comprehensive research is crucial before selecting an Android app developer partner. Careful consideration of all factors is necessary for making an informed decision that yields successful results. Consider the company's track record and portfolio to ensure they have experience creating quality apps that meet client needs.

Take the time to read through each company's reviews, too. You want to check out reviews of past clients to gauge the quality of the development process and final product.

Given the multitude of exceptional companies, it is crucial to thoroughly research and select the most suitable one for your project. Be assured that with this rigorous process, your Android app will be in capable hands.

Frequently Asked Questions

What factors should be considered when selecting an Android app development company?

A successful Android app dev project aims for product scalability, revenue generation, and client satisfaction. Indeed, there exist several crucial elements that play a major role in any successful Android app development venture. To ensure that a mobile app development company can meet the specific needs of your app, evaluate its expertise, experience, and track record. Customer reviews provide valuable insight into a company's service and products.

When selecting a development team, ensure you partner with a company that’s knowledgeable of current trends and the latest technologies in the mobile app space. Finally, understand your project goals and have a clear completion timeline in mind to discern if the company can fulfill requirements within the given timeframe.

What distinguishes Android from iOS?

Android and iOS are both mobile operating systems. Android is open-source, meaning its source code is available for everyone to explore and modify, while iOS is closed-source and exclusively owned by Apple. Android's customizable interface allows for greater app design options, while iOS offers better security features with its closed ecosystem. Android's larger marketplace provides more app options, and it has a greater market share worldwide compared to iOS.

Android devices come in different shapes and sizes, while most iOS devices are Apple products. As such, each platform requires different development strategies. That said, each has its advantages and disadvantages, so choose based on project needs.

About the Author and Expert Reviewer
Geri Mileva, an experienced IP network engineer and distinguished writer at Influencer Marketing Hub, specializes in the realms of the Creator Economy, AI, blockchain, and the Metaverse. Her articles, featured in The Huffington Post, Ravishly, and various other respected newspapers and magazines, offer in-depth analysis and insights into these cutting-edge technology domains. Geri's technological background enriches her writing, providing a unique perspective that bridges complex technical concepts with accessible, engaging content for diverse audiences.
Djanan Kasumovic
Expert Reviewer